About FAMILY GARDEN SALAD
FAMILY GARDEN SALAD is a low-calorie food with 80 calories per 100-gram serving. Its primary macronutrient source is fat, providing 1g of protein, 7g of carbohydrates, and 5g of fat. It also contributes 2g of dietary fiber per serving. This food belongs to the Pickles, Olives, Peppers & Relishes category.
Ingredients
ROMAINE LETTUCE, BALSAMIC VINAIGRETTE (BALSAMIC VINEGAR, CANOLA OIL, WATER, SUGAR, OLIVE OIL, ROMANO CHEESE [MILK, CULTURE, SALT, ENZYMES], SALT, DIJON MUSTARD [WATER, MUSTARD SEED, DISTILLED VINEGAR, SALT, WHITE WINE, CITRIC ACID, TURMERIC {COLOR}, TARTARIC ACID, SPICES], NATURAL FLAVOR, SPICES, DRIED SHALLOTS, XANTHAN GUM, DRIED GARLIC, DRIED ONION, LEMON JUICE CONCENTRATE, DRIED BELL PEPPER), CARROTS, RED CABBAGE, CUCUMBER, GRAPE TOMATOES.
Calorie Breakdown
At 80 calories per 100 grams, FAMILY GARDEN SALAD gets 5% of its calories from protein, 35% from carbohydrates, and 56% from fat. This is lower than most foods and comparable to fruits and vegetables.
